Foundation Damage Repair in Columbus, OH
Foundation damage rep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a property’s foundation. These projects typically involve identifying and fixing problems such as cracks, settling, shifting, or bowing walls that can compromise the safety and value of a home. Homeowners often request foundation repair when they notice signs like u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, or visible cracks in walls and the foundation itself. Proper assessment and repair are essential to prevent further damage and maintain the structural soundness of the property.
Before requesting foundation damage rep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the underlying causes, and the most appropriate repair methods. It’s important to consider factors such as soil conditions, drainage issues, and previous foundation problems that may influence the repair approach. Clear communication about the scope of work, potential costs, and expected outcomes can help homeowners make informed decisions about restoring stability to their homes.

Common Foundation Damage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repairs - addressing visible cracks to prevent further structural damage.
Pier and beam foundation stabilization - reinforcing and leveling homes with pier and beam systems.
Basement foundation repair - fixing settlement issues and bowing walls in basement structures.
Concrete slab repair - restoring uneven or cracked concrete slabs to improve stability.
Waterproofing and drainage solutions - preventing water intrusion that can weaken foundations.
Soil stabilization and underpinning - strengthening soil support to prevent future foundation movement.
Foundation Damage Repair Questions
What are signs of foundation damage? Common signs include c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and sticking doors or windows.
What causes foundation damage? Causes often include soil movement, poor drainage, or settling over time.
How can foundation issues affect a property? They can lead to structural instability, increased repair costs, and decreased property value.
What types of foundation repair methods are available? Methods vary from underpinning and piering to slab stabilization, depending on the damage.
